The CBS special, titled Rob Reiner: Scenes From a Life, will air tonight, December 21, at 20:30 ET. This one-hour program pays tribute to the acclaimed filmmaker and actor, who recently passed away alongside his wife, Michelle Reiner. The special will be available for streaming on Paramount+ after its broadcast.

Viewers can expect a heartfelt exploration of Reiner’s extensive career, featuring interviews with notable figures in the industry. Stars such as Kathy Bates, Annette Bening, Albert Brooks, Michael Douglas, Kiefer Sutherland, Jerry O’Connell, and Mandy Patinkin will share their insights and memories, shedding light on Reiner’s influence both on and off the screen.

Last Interview and Iconic Films

The special will include Reiner’s final sit-down interview with Lesley Stahl, which aired on 60 Minutes this past fall. This poignant conversation offers a glimpse into the thoughts and experiences of a man whose work has left an indelible mark on the entertainment industry.

The program will also highlight some of Reiner’s most beloved films, including The Princess Bride, When Harry Met Sally, Misery, This Is Spinal Tap, The American President, and Stand by Me. Additionally, his role as a star in the classic sitcom All in the Family will be featured, illustrating the breadth of his contributions to film and television.
